Puppy Selling Age: Regional Regulations
Determining the appropriate age for selling puppies varies widely by region. There isn't a uniform law; instead, each state has its own guidelines. Some states prohibit the transfer of puppies under a certain age, generally approximately eight to twelve weeks old, citing the importance of maternal socialization and physical needs. However , other locations have less restrictions, potentially allowing younger sales. Always check your state's specific requirements concerning puppy sales, as penalties for violations can be severe . Furthermore , municipal ordinances might also establish further restrictions.

Selling Puppies Early Soon? Understanding Age Restrictions
Many hopeful puppy individuals want to generate a quick return on their investment , but distributing puppies before they reach the ideal age can have serious consequences . Generally, puppies should stay with their parent and pack until at least 8 weeks and a few days , and preferably longer—up to 12 weeks—to ensure proper growth. Separating them too soon can lead to emotional challenges later in life, and responsible breeders appreciate the importance of these vital early phases.
